I just submitted a bug report (Bug 4455; http://d.puremagic.com/issues/post_bug.cgi) because std.math doesn't let you take the square root of an integer w/o an explicit cast. This has been a subtle annoyance to me for ages. Is it ok if I just fix this, or is there some reason I'm not aware of (i.e. other than a simple oversight) why sqrt() doesn't already forward integers to sqrt(real)?
